City to mark property lines along riverfront pathway
The city of Hudson will pay $3,500 to have a surveyor mark the boundary of a pedestrian pathway from Lakefront Park to St. Croix Street. Auth Consulting & Associates will do the work, which will involve retracing and re-staking boundaries established in a previous survey.

‘We’re the tortoise, not the hare’
St. Croix Animal Friends has owned land debt-free since the fall of 2010 near the intersection of Interstate 94 and Hwy. 65 in Roberts, but building an animal shelter on that land might still be a few years off.
